Suggest Treatment For Cold , Ear Ache And Nasal Congestion
My left ear sounds like a blown out speaker and i can hear the beating when im sitting still. It happened after i had a cold and my nose was stuffed up so to unclog it i used a swab and pushed it into my nasal cavity to dry it up and my ear messed up right after that and has stayed this way for 2 weeks now.
Understanding your concern. As per your query you have symptoms of cold , ear ache and nasal congestion which could be due to three possible causes 1) acute otitis media 2) Upper respiratory tract infection 3) blockage of the Eustachian tube. I would suggest you to take steam inhalation with vaporizers, avoid cold beverages and carbonated drinks and keep sipping warm water. You have take combination of Decongestant nasal drops along with levocetirizine + Montelukast and antibiotic such as azithromycin. Your symptoms will resolve in 4-5 days. If symptoms keeps on persisting visit ENT specialist once and get some routine blood investigation with sputum tests and Chest X- ray to get diagnosed first and start treatment as per diagnosis.
